Output 300720db87ea8ccb339223076a44ac891686fbe6fe07b6d523f165855b39ab15:1

value
3399824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4663927d6b9fab08db80329ba7ca24ec51856f58 OP_EQUAL
address
387CWNVpLN5XeRWKZ4tcBPTMdWLKEPXJV5
transaction
300720db87ea8ccb339223076a44ac891686fbe6fe07b6d523f165855b39ab15
spent
true